Hello Ritu!
Yes, the responsive version is like that. Another workaround could be to hide an element in the desktop so it will appear only in the mobile viewport and reverse. But you can build your mobile pages as explained here: https://tagdiv.com/newspaper-10-3-7-update-brings-customizable-and-fast-mobile-pages
There are only 3 options that you can use:
1. Responsive version: A responsive version of your website looks similar to the desktop version. TagDiv Composer is used to edit the page. Click on the mobile viewport: https://www.screencast.com/t/XDQJedlggSB. You can see your mobile version there and edit or adjust the elements to look better.
2. Mobile pages: https://tagdiv.com/newspaper-10-3-7-update-brings-customizable-and-fast-mobile-pages
3. Mobile theme plugin: The Mobile Theme is a performance-optimized theme included in the main Newspaper theme that only loads on mobile devices. It comes with its own templates and designs for pages, posts, categories, etc., so your current templates from the desktop theme will get converted to the mobile theme layout. Please see https://forum.tagdiv.com/the-mobile-theme/ and https://forum.tagdiv.com/mobile-theme-introduction/ for more information.
A full explanation is here: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=SpGkOnJeNZY
If you need to use mobile version 1 or 2, then you need to uninstall the Mobile Theme plugin and AMP.
